BharOS : India's own Operating System


 BharOS:Indian Operating System 



       Yesterday the Union Minister for Communications, Electronics and Information Technology, Union Education Minister Dharmendra Pradhan and Union Telecom and Rail Minister Ashwini Vaishnav taken the test of India's Own Operating System known as BharOS which developed by IIT Madras

      It is the Initiative by IIT madras under the Initiative of PM Narendra Modi's "Aatma Nirbhar Bharat " and "Digital India". IIT Madras has incubated facilities to boost new technologies and startups, JandK operations Private Limited is on of them. The BharOS Operating system is made by the help of JandK operations. According to developers it will benifit 100 crore of indian mobile users. 

Currently this OS is not available for common people. IIT Madras is looking to collaborate with private startups, Indian tech companies, and government organizations  to develop it at world level to eliminate the dependency over Android and iOS. It is incubated by Pravartak Technologies Foundation a section 8 (Non-profit-company) established by IIT Madras.  This foundation is funded by the central government's Department of Science and Technology under its National Mission on Interdisciplinary Cyber-Physical Systems(NMICPS).

      There will be no pre installed apps (NDA) No Default Apps. According to developers NOTA (Native  Over The Air) is pre installed on the device so user don't need to mannually update their phone.It is enabled with PASS(Private Apps Store Services). It will provide trusted apps list to install and use blindly.BharOS is currently used by Sensitive government Organizations that have strict security and privacy requirements.

    The whole Computer OS market is captured by microsoft and of mobile phones, by Android and iOS. In India several startups also developed indian OS but they are not much popular or they are limited to feature  phones only. Reliance Jio also have an OS named KaiOS but it only available in Jio feature phone. Jio's smartphone runs on Pragati OS which is developed by Jio and Google. PhonePe's IndusOS, Snaplion, Plobal App, Instappy, TableHero. Government agency CDAC in 2015 also made own OS named BOSS (Bharat Operating System Solutions), its latest version of 2019 called Unnati is used by very few  institutions and individuals.

      BharOS is an Android Open Source Project (AOSP). It is made by using google's AOSP plateform. As it has no pre installed apps so it will have more storage and improved battery life. It is a government funded project to develop free and open source Operating System by Department of Science and Technology. It aims to lower the dependencies on foreign OS.
